### Runbook: Account Recovery — Receipt Mailer (Tithewell)

If the service account for the Tithewell donation-receipt mailer is locked, receipts queue but do not send. Confirm queue depth in the Perchlight dashboard, then initiate recovery from the admin console. Rotate the SMTP credential afterward and verify one test receipt end-to-end. Recovery requires dual approval and is fully audited. At the recovery prompt, supply the passphrase below.

vault phrase of kawep-tahog = ulaix-briath

**Ticket: Config drift on ScanBridge prod**

ScanBridge barcode scanner integration in prod no longer matches the baseline in Fennwick's config repo. Timeout and retry settings were hand-edited during the Oct incident and never backported. Scanners at the Delmore warehouse are intermittently dropping reads. Do not restart the service until values are reconciled. For reference, the expected baseline configuration is as follows.

deployment values, yadug-bawif:
[framir]
team = pelox
access_code = ac_a38ab2
owner = tamion.julael
host = framir.tolvaqlabs.test
port = 11211
peer = tammir.zemvargrid.local
salt = 2215ef03
pin = 1541

**Mgmt Meeting Minutes — Retiring the Brightline Range**

Quick recap for sales leads at Fenholt Supplies: we agreed to retire the Brightline fixture range by year-end. Remaining stock moves to clearance pricing next month, and accounts on standing orders get migrated to the Lumetta range. Trade-in incentives were approved in principle. The confidential note on next steps sits just below.

board note of bajof-bajeg: The pricing group signed off on a budget of $13.4 million for Project Sildor. The renewal with Lamixek Holdings closes at $48.9 million a year, 49 percent above the last contract.